What does Scarlotte mean and where does it come from?

Scarlotte is a modern variation of the classic name Charlotte, which was historically popularized in France. The name is often associated with strength and individuality. The story of Scarlotte

Scarlotte is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 1979. With 31 total births recorded, Scarlotte remains relatively uncommon. The name has grown more popular over time, rising from #14968 in 2015 to #8390 in 2021.
